The GE IS200RCSAG1ABB is a Redundant Control System (RCSA) processor module used in the GE Mark VIe turbine control platform. It functions as a main system controller, executing turbine control logic, managing I/O communication, and supporting high-availability redundant architectures.

This module is designed for critical power generation environments, where system uptime, fault tolerance, and deterministic control are essential. It plays a central role in coordinating real-time turbine operations, protection functions, and distributed I/O communication.


Technical Specifications

The IS200RCSAG1ABB is a high-performance industrial controller built for redundancy and reliability.

ParameterSpecification
Module TypeRedundant Control System Processor (RCSA)
SeriesGE Mark VIe
FunctionMain turbine control processor
ArchitectureRedundant (dual/triple modular system support)
Processor TypeIndustrial embedded CPU
MemoryRAM + Flash (firmware + application storage)
CommunicationEthernet-based IONet / control network
I/O InterfaceDistributed I/O via Mark VIe I/O packs
Redundancy SupportHot standby / failover capable
DiagnosticsStatus LEDs + onboard health monitoring
FirmwareMark VIe control application software
Power SupplyBackplane-fed low-voltage DC
MountingRack-mounted in control cabinet
Operating Temperature0°C to 60°C (industrial standard)

This module enables high-speed deterministic control with redundancy, ensuring continuous operation even in the event of hardware failure.

Technical FAQs

1. What is the GE IS200RCSAG1ABB used for?
It is a redundant control processor used in GE Mark VIe turbine control systems.

2. What is its main function?
To execute turbine control logic and manage system communication.

3. Does it support redundancy?
Yes, it supports redundant configurations with automatic failover.

4. What systems is it compatible with?
GE Mark VIe turbine control platform.

5. What type of communication does it use?
Ethernet-based industrial control networks (IONet).

6. Is it a CPU module?
Yes, it is a primary control processor.

7. What happens if one controller fails?
The redundant controller takes over without interrupting operation.

8. Does it include diagnostics?
Yes, onboard diagnostics and LED indicators are included.

9. Is it still manufactured?
It is generally considered a legacy/transition module, replaced by newer UCSA controllers.

10. Why is it important?
It ensures continuous, reliable, and safe turbine control operation.
